Abstract
In this paper, the application and mechanism of gas sensing technology based on absorption spectroscopy have been described. And absorption features in different wave ranges for common pollutant/dangerous gases have been summarized. Then, the application status of gas sensing technology based absorption spectroscopy has been studied. At last, a conclusion and prospect were obtained: spectral analysis/detection technology is the main part of the application and research of the gas sensing technology based on absorption spectroscopy, researches and applications on gas identification based on absorption spectroscopy are scarce, gas sensing technology based on absorption spectroscopy has great potential and better characteristics but limited by the developmental level of instruments, so it has not been widely used.
